Do MAC ever make items permanent in one country/continent and not another? It seems unlikely but perhaps they need to gauge Dazzleglass sales in the UK and Europe before making a decision?
|
Sort of. They have certain products in Asia that they don't carry in the US. The Lightful line is an example. That used to be an asian exclusive. Currently, there are even more Lightful items availabe in certain asian markets than what we now have available in the US.
There are also the Euristocrats lipsticks which are only carried in asian, indian, african and m.e. markets.
I would be pretty surprised if they made Dazzleglass perm in the US and not elsewhere though. Just based on the type of product that it is.
